About Pirelli 275/55 details
The Pirelli Scorpion STR in 275/55 R20 111H is a road-focused SUV tyre designed for drivers who want a practical balance between paved-road behaviour and occasional light off-road use. Its relatively wide 275 mm footprint gives the vehicle a substantial contact area, while the 55-series profile leaves enough sidewall to absorb some road imperfections without turning the steering response excessively soft.
The H speed rating allows speeds up to 210 km/h, while the 111 load index corresponds to a maximum load of 1,090 kg per tyre. This makes the configuration relevant to larger SUVs and light trucks that require a higher load capacity, but the exact vehicle fitment should always be checked against the manufacturer's approved tyre size and load requirements.
A 20-inch SUV size with a useful balance
The 275/55 R20 dimension is noticeably wider than many conventional SUV touring sizes, which can contribute to a planted feel during normal road driving. The 55 aspect ratio also avoids the very short sidewall character found on some high-performance 20-inch applications.
In everyday use, that combination should feel more substantial over broken urban roads and expansion joints than a lower-profile performance tyre, although the large 20-inch wheel still means that sharp potholes and damaged road edges deserve attention.
The 111H service description is particularly important for buyers carrying passengers or luggage. The load index allows each tyre to support up to 1,090 kg under the specified conditions, while the H rating indicates a maximum approved speed of 210 km/h. These figures do not automatically make the tyre suitable for every large SUV. The vehicle's original specification, axle loads, wheel dimensions and manufacturer's recommendations must still match.
How the Scorpion STR feels on the road?
Pirelli positions the Scorpion STR as a tyre that combines on-road performance with some off-road capability. Its symmetric tread design uses a continuous central rib, inclined tread blocks and extensive siping. The central rib is intended to support consistent contact and even wear while helping maintain a more controlled steering feel on paved surfaces.
The block arrangement gives the tread more flexibility than a purely highway-oriented pattern, which is useful when the vehicle leaves smooth asphalt for gravel or lightly uneven terrain.
The Scorpion STR is not an aggressive all-terrain tyre, and that distinction matters. Its tread is better suited to drivers who spend most of their time on highways and city roads but occasionally encounter gravel tracks, compacted surfaces or mild off-road conditions. It should not be chosen as a substitute for a dedicated all-terrain tyre where deep mud, loose rock or severe terrain is a regular part of driving.
Wet roads, noise and daily comfort
The tread's silica and natural-rubber compound, together with the extensive siping, is designed to maintain useful grip on wet surfaces and in light snow conditions. The tyre is not marked for severe snow service, so buyers who regularly drive in serious winter conditions should look toward a dedicated winter or severe-snow-rated option instead.
The continuous centre rib also has a practical effect on everyday driving. By maintaining a more consistent contact pattern, it is intended to contribute to ride comfort, reduced tread noise and more uniform wear. The Scorpion STR therefore makes more sense for long-distance SUV use than for drivers seeking the sharpest possible steering response.
Its broader tread and 55-series sidewall provide a more substantial road presence, but drivers prioritising sports-car-like turn-in may find its character less immediate than a dedicated performance tyre.
Where this Pirelli configuration fits best?
This configuration is most suitable for SUV and light-truck owners whose driving is predominantly on paved roads but who do not want a tyre limited exclusively to perfect asphalt. It can appeal to buyers who value a quieter, more comfortable road-going character while retaining some flexibility for occasional light off-road travel.
The 20-inch fitment also suits vehicles where appearance and road stability matter, while the 111 load index provides useful carrying capacity for appropriately specified vehicles.
Drivers looking specifically for maximum tread life should compare the actual warranty and expected service life available for their market before buying. A tyre's real mileage depends heavily on alignment, inflation pressure, vehicle weight, driving style, temperature and road surface. The same applies to heat resistance. Correct pressure and vehicle loading are more important to safe high-temperature operation than relying on the tyre's H rating alone.
Who should choose it?
The Scorpion STR is a sensible option for an SUV owner who wants one tyre for everyday urban driving, highway travel and occasional light off-road use. Compared with a purely road-biased touring tyre, its tread design gives it a more versatile character, while compared with a true all-terrain tyre, it remains oriented toward quieter and more comfortable paved-road driving.
That makes the Pirelli configuration particularly relevant to drivers who spend most of their time on asphalt but do not want to avoid every unpaved road.
It may be less suitable for someone whose priority is maximum cornering response, extreme off-road traction, severe winter capability or the lowest possible purchase price.
